Both tools have similar popularity levels, with Grok Build having 26,065 stars and Tabby having 33,837 stars on GitHub. In terms of developer contributions, Grok Build has 4,897 forks, indicating strong developer engagement.
Grok Build is growing faster, adding 3,089 stars in the last 30 days (+13%) against adding 46 stars for Tabby (+0.1%). Grok Build is the smaller project of the two, so it is closing the gap rather than extending a lead.
Grok Build shows more recent development activity with its last commit 10 hours ago, while Tabby was last updated 2 months ago. This suggests Grok Build is being more actively maintained.
Both tools share common technology foundations, being built with JavaScript, Bash, Python, Rust. However, they differ in their additional technology choices: Tabby leverages CSS, Typescript, JSX, Next.js, Java, C++, Kotlin, Lua.
Tabby has been in development longer, starting 3 years ago, compared to Grok Build which began 1 month ago. This 3.4-year head start suggests Tabby may have more mature features and established processes.
Both projects use the Apache-2.0 license, providing identical terms for usage and distribution.
Grok Build also focuses on AI Coding Agents while Tabby extends into AI Coding Assistants.
Tabby provides self-hosting options for complete data control and customization, while Grok Build may be primarily cloud-based or require different deployment approaches.
